A lot of first-time founders think GST registration only matters once the business starts making profit.

But that’s usually not how it works.

In many cases, GST registration depends on things like:

> turnover

> interstate sales

> selling online

> type of service/business

Meaning some startups and freelancers may need it much earlier than expected.

We’ve seen founders ignore this in the early stage thinking:

“we’ll handle it later.”

Then later becomes:

• notices

• penalties

• marketplace/payment issues

• unnecessary stress

Honestly, compliance is one of those things nobody likes talking about while building a startup—but fixing mistakes later is always more expensive.
